Choosing the right book is key to fostering a love of reading. We recommend:
- Consider your child's interests: Whether they love animals, sports, or fantasy, we have books to match their passions.
- Look at reading levels: Choose books that challenge your child slightly without being frustrating.
- Explore different genres: Encourage variety to broaden your child's literary horizons.
- Read together: Even as children become independent readers, sharing books can be a wonderful bonding experience.
Remember, every child's reading journey is unique. Our diverse collection allows you to tailor your choices to your child's individual needs and preferences.

A good rule of thumb is the "five-finger test". Have your child read a page from the book. If they struggle with more than five words, the book might be too challenging.
